About

Cihan Aslan is a scholar working on Surgery, Clinical Psychology and Psychiatry and Mental health. According to data from OpenAlex, Cihan Aslan has authored 13 papers receiving a total of 307 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 10 papers in Surgery, 3 papers in Clinical Psychology and 3 papers in Psychiatry and Mental health. Recurrent topics in Cihan Aslan's work include Scoliosis diagnosis and treatment (4 papers), Orthopedic Surgery and Rehabilitation (3 papers) and Pelvic and Acetabular Injuries (2 papers). Cihan Aslan is often cited by papers focused on Scoliosis diagnosis and treatment (4 papers), Orthopedic Surgery and Rehabilitation (3 papers) and Pelvic and Acetabular Injuries (2 papers). Cihan Aslan collaborates with scholars based in Türkiye and United States. Cihan Aslan's co-authors include Fatih Ünal, Füsun Çuhadaroğlu Çetin, Halime Tuna Çak Esen, Devrim Akdemir, Dilşad Foto Özdemir, Bilge Merve Kalaycı, Ferhunde Öktem, Sadriye Ebru Çengel Kültür, Muharrem Yazıcı and Z. Deniz Olgun and has published in prestigious journals such as Spine, Journal of Pediatric Orthopaedics and The American Journal of Emergency Medicine.
